“My dear friends, don’t believe everything you hear. Carefully weigh and examine what people tell you. Not everyone who talks about God comes from God. There are a lot of lying preachers loose in the world.” – 1 John 4:1 MSG
We have to be careful most especially with what we listen to and take in. For example, if you have a friend who keeps talking bad about someone you don’t really know, after sometime what the person tells you settles somewhere in your mind and you begin to behave somehow towards who was talked about.
This behavior doesn’t help you as a person because you’re already judging and harbouring negative feelings towards someone and you are not even sure if what was talked about is true.
Your friends might have told you what he or she said out of spite for the other person or most likely for their personal gain so you don’t get to benefit from who was talked about.
The only reasons I think a preacher will mislead his or her congregation is for personal gains as well as knowledge their congregation don’t have a deep relationship with God so they will take any word that comes to them.
This is why building a personal relationship with God is of GREAT importance because the HolySpirit will immediately let you know what the preacher is saying is not true but if you don’t know him, just like your friend would tell you something bad about someone else you don’t know and it will sink in and lead to you acting out, because if you knew the person, you would most likely vouch for him or her or probably not even listen at all.
Don’t believe everything you hear, examine it first before you take it in.
